#f14641 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f14641 is composed of 94.5% red, 27.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 73%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 60%. #f14641 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c82 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f14641 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f14641 has RGB values of R:241, G:70,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.73,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15812161.

Shades and Tints of #f14641
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0101 is the darkest color, while #fef8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f14641
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9797 is the less saturated color, while #f93f39 is the most saturated one.
